Abstract
We present the results of ultrasonic researches of bulk sample of nematic liquid crystal, oriented by joint action of electric and magnetic fields. The measurements were carried out in a nematic mixture with δϵ>0 previously oriented by a magnetic field. An electric field, applied to the LC sample induced the changes of a director orientation, and ultrasonic attenuation coefficient. The experimental dependencies are satisfactory described by the equation of motion of the director.
